That irrepressible bad boy, Bart Simpson: Prince of Pranks, is badder than ever and up to his old tricks in this glorious comic collection from merrymaker of mischief, Matt Groening. These delectable graphic Simpsons funnies from the creator of Life in Hell and Futurama will have you howling with laughter all the way to the Principal’s Office. No joke!

Matthew Abram Groening is an American cartoonist, television producer and writer from Portland, Oregon.

Groening is best known as the creator of The Simpsons. He is also the creator of Futurama and the author of the weekly comic strip Life in Hell. Groening distributed Life in Hell in the book corner of Licorice Pizza, a record store in which he worked.

He made his first professional cartoon sale to the avant-garde Wet magazine in 1978. The cartoon is still carried in 250 weekly newspapers.
